Posted By: fkw
They are fairly scarce, I call them W517-2 or W517 Mini |

Posted By: Randall Adams
I noticed two of the cards that I have, have a bluish hue while the other looks to be black and white. Is one color variation more scarce than the other? |

Posted By: fkw
The dark red one IMO is the toughest color, many think its cut from the postcard, but I have seen one that looks to have dotted lines on the bottom edge. |
